Pogačar Strikes Again at Paris-Nice

UAE Team Emirates (France) - Press Release: Seventh season victory for Slovenian.

UAE Team Emirates were once again victorious on the second summit arrival at Paris-Nice taking their second win of the week through Tadej Pogačar.

After a day of forced rest caused by the strong wind, UAE Team Emirates’ captain conquered stage 7 of the French race, 142,9 km from Nice to the Col de la Couillole, preceding his direct rivals for the general classification David Gaudu (Groupama-FDJ), 2nd at 2”, and Jonas Vingegaard (Jumbo-Visma), 3rd at 6”.

Stage 7 results:

  1. Tadej Pogačar (UAE Team Emirates) 3h56’08”
  2. David Gaudu (Groupama-FDJ) +2“
  3. Jonas Vingegaard (Jumbo-Visma) +6“

General classification after stage 7:

  1. Tadej Pogačar (UAE Team Emirates) 21h10’50”
  2. David Gaudu (Groupama-FDJ) +12“
  3. Jonas Vingegaard (Jumbo-Visma) +58“
